It's Time to Clean the Liberty Bell!
News story originally written on 11/11/99
The Liberty Bell 7 is getting a bath! It was found deep in the Atlantic Ocean this past summer. It sank there
in 1961. Astronaut Gus Grissom flew it, and he got out before it sank.
The spacecraft has 25,000 pieces, and each one is getting cleaned! Scientists say
it will take 6 months before it is all done. People can watch scientists clean the capsule at the Cosmophere in Kansas.
Lots of neat things were found inside the spacecraft too. A pencil and paper were inside a pouch, and old pennies were all over the floor.
Scientists also found the cap to the door that blew off. The door came off too soon, causing the Liberty Bell to sink.
